Ep. 34 Today we catch up with Asa Shutts, owner of Shuts Productions and Shutter and Splice. Asa shares her journey of navigating personal and business challenges, including her son's rare genetic disorder, the passing of her father, and her own health issues. Despite the hardships, Asa has learned to say no more often, charge her worth, and pivot her business towards corporate work and real estate photography. She also emphasizes the importance of finding joy and purpose in her work, supporting companies that are making a positive impact, and leaving the world a better place.

"I say no a lot more... and I am getting better at charging my worth, which has always been a big struggle for me." - Asa

Key Takeaways:

  • Personal adversity does not have to halt professional progress; Asa's experience shows it can redefine and refocus business goals.
  • Strategic business decisions, like moving away from wedding photography to corporate projects, can lead to a healthier work-life balance and personal satisfaction.
  • Charging one's worth and setting clear boundaries is crucial for long-term success in business and personal well-being.
  • The entrepreneurial journey is one of constant adaptation, learning, and reevaluation of personal and professional aspirations.
  • A relentless positive outlook and the ability to find silver linings in difficult situations are valuable traits for any business owner.

About the Guest:

Asa Shutts is a seasoned photographer and videographer who runs Shutts Productions and Shutter and Splice. Based in Rochester, New York, she specializes in photo and video production. Alongside her passion for capturing personal milestones like weddings and family moments, Asa has developed a keen interest and expertise in corporate shoots, particularly real estate and architectural photography. Asa is known for her entrepreneurial spirit, constantly learning new skills and exploring varied interests to enrich both her personal and professional life.
